In the indian constitution, there are three organ of the state. These are the legislature, the executive and the judiciary. The legislature refers to our elected representatives. The executive is a small group of people who are responsible for implementing laws and running the government.in order to prevent the misuse of power by any one branch of the state, the constitution says that each of these organs should exercise different power through this, each organ act as a check on the other organ of the state and this ensures the balance of power between all there. there are six fundamental right in the indian constitution. These includes right to equality, right to freedom, right again exploitation, right to freedom of religion, culture and educational right, right to constitutional remedies.
